A Header-Only C Vector Database Library: Initial Release and Community Discussion

The news announces the release of 'vdb', a header-only C vector database library. Published on February 14, 2026, and sourced from Hacker News, the project is available on GitHub. OpenViking: An Open-Source Context Database for AI Agents, Designed for Hierarchical Context Management and Self-Evolution

OpenViking, an open-source context database developed by volcengine, is specifically designed for AI agents like openclaw. It unifies the management of agent context, including memory, resources, and skills, through a file system paradigm. This innovative approach enables hierarchical context passing and supports the self-evolution of AI agents, streamlining how agents access and utilize necessary information for their operations and development.
